Abstract

The invention discloses a spinning system.The spinning system comprises a drying machine with an air outlet and spinning devices with air windows, and is characterized by further comprising a shell with an inlet end and outlet ends, the inlet end of the shell is communicated with the air outlet of the drying machine, the outlet ends of the shell are communicated with the air windows of the spinning devices, and a cooling machine and an electric heater are further sequentially arranged in the shell in the flow direction of air; hot wind output by the air outlet of the self-drying machine can be input into the shell; when the temperature of the hot air is higher than the standard temperature, the cooling machine can be started to reduce the temperature; when the temperature of the hot air is lower than the standard temperature, the electric heater can be started to increase the temperature, and therefore the temperature in the spinning system can be more effectively collected.

Detailed description of the invention
Description in conjunction with accompanying drawing and the specific embodiment of the invention, it is possible to clearly understand the details of the present invention.But, the detailed description of the invention of invention described herein, only for illustrative purpose, and can not be understood as by any way is limitation of the present invention.Under the teachings of the present invention, technical staff is it is contemplated that based on the arbitrarily possible deformation of the present invention, these are regarded as belonging to the scope of the present invention.
The invention discloses a kind of textile department, there is the dehydrator 1 of air outlet 11, there is the device for spinning 5 of air regulator, its feature exists, described textile department also includes the housing 2 with arrival end 21 and the port of export 22, the arrival end 21 of described housing 2 is connected with the air outlet 11 of described dehydrator 1, the port of export 22 of described housing 2 is connected with the air regulator of described device for spinning 5, is also disposed with cooler 3 and electric heater 4 in described housing 2 along the flow direction of wind.The hot blast exported from the air outlet 11 of dehydrator 1 can input in housing 2, when hot blast temperature is above standard temperature, can pass through to open cooler 3 to reduce temperature, when hot blast temperature is lower than standard temperature, can pass through to open electric heater 4 to improve temperature, thus more effectively the temperature in textile department being collected.
Preferably, the temperature of the air regulator of described device for spinning 5 is 21-24 degree Celsius, and blast is 400-500Pa, and humidity is 90%.
Preferably, described dehydrator 1 includes the first drying unit, the second drying unit for Masterbatch is dried that are dried for white is cut into slices;The air outlet 11 of described first drying unit is connected with the arrival end 21 of described housing 2 respectively with the air outlet 11 of described second drying unit.
Preferably, dosing machine that described textile department includes the mixing arrangement for the white completing to dry section and the Masterbatch completing to dry carry out being mixed to form mixture, be used for the proportioning according to Masterbatch Yu white cut sheet is controlled the blanking velocity of Masterbatch, it is used for described mixture carrying out the melting plant of melted formation fused mass, being used for controlling the dosing pump of the blanking velocity of described fused mass, device for spinning 5 is multiple, each device for spinning 5 is for forming yarn fabric by described fused mass, and the air regulator of each device for spinning 5 is connected with the port of export 22 of housing 2.
Preferably, described textile department includes the oiling device for adding oil preparation on described yarn fabric.
